A lightweight, smart JavaScript storage library that makes state persistence as easy as modifying a plain object.
Tired of writing this? 🤮
const data = JSON.parse(localStorage.getItem("settings"));
data.count += 1;
localStorage.setItem("settings", JSON.stringify(data));But what if, WHAT IF, you can just do this↓
settings.count += 1;- 🪄 Deep Reactive Proxy: Modify any nested property, and it saves automatically.
- 🏗️ Innovative Flat Storage: Breaks down nested JSON objects into flat Key-Value pairs. No need to serialize the entire object just to update a deep property!
- ⚡ Smart Debouncing: Automatically merges frequent writes (like array operations) for extreme performance.
- 🔒 Type Safety: Blocks un-storable values (like
undefinedorfunction) to keep your storage safe. - 🌐 Framework Agnostic: Works in any vanilla JS or framework environment.

console.log("Synchronously read arrTest from proxy:", JSON.stringify(syncReadArr));How does the magic work?
- Deep Proxy: We intercept all
get,set, anddeleteoperations on the object, tracking the exact path (e.g.,["user", "profile", "name"]). - Schema-Driven Flat Structure: In
FlatJSONStorage, we maintain a schema to flatten nested JSON objects in the storage layer. When you modifydata.a.b.c, only thea.b.ckey is updated in the adapter. Say goodbye to the performance nightmare of saving the whole object!
